xrpoly
draw a regular polygon
Calling Sequence
xrpoly(orig,n,r,[theta])
Arguments
- orig
- vector of size 2. 
- n
- integer, number of sides. 
- r
- real scalar. 
- theta
- real, angle in radian; 0 is the default value. 
Description
xrpoly draws a regular polygon with n sides contained in the 
    circle of diameter 
    r and with the origin of the circle set at point orig. 
    theta  specifies a rotation angle in radian. This function uses
    the current graphics scales.
Examples
plot2d(0,0,-1,"012"," ",[0,0,10,10]) xrpoly([5,5],5,5)
